“The 21 century begins now” – this is the headline of the october issue of the Esquire Magazine in USA. The Publishing Company has teamed up with E-Ink Technologies to realize the World’s First E-Ink Magazine Cover.
Newsstands have never seen anything like Esquire’s October edition. Its cover blinks. Meanwhile, its inside cover also features a blinking Ford ad. The digital enhancements are all a part of the Hearst publication’s 75th anniversary as well as its attempt to pioneer a new magazine publishing concept. 100,000 of the battery-powered covers were hand-assembled by work crews in China and Mexico. The limited issues of the Esquire Magazine were sold out immetiatly.
What is really surprising that beside the complicated assembly of the magazine, the logistical part was also a big challenge. Due to the hot summer the magazines had to transported in refrigerated trucks.
The technology behind can be compared to eBook Reader Amazon Kindle.

The japanese Knowledge Dynamics Initiative (KDI) sent a high ranking delegation to Europe in August 2008. The topic of the Knowledge Bechmarking Program is called “Driving Innovative paradigm management”. The goal of the management program was to exchange Knowledge-Management, to analyse best practice-examples, and to put knowledge into practice for their own organizational transformation.
The program in Germany was organized by Ahead of Time and included several expert keynotes, company visits and networking events. The japanese delegation met and discussed with experts from BMW Group, Fraunhofer Institute, Swarovski, Nokia Siemens Networks, Siemens and others.

Knowledge Dynamics Initiative (KDI) is a think tank team inside of Fuji Xerox. KDI provides
benchmarking, research, and consulting services to their Japanese clients. Since 2000, KDI is conducting a research study and practice with Mr. Rory Chase of Teleos, American Productivity & Quality Center (APQC) and Professor Ikujiro Nonaka (Xerox Distinguished Professor, Haas School of Business, UC Berkeley). Currently, there are 50 Japanese major companies who are aiming for innovation and knowledge-based management in our “Knowledge Community.”
Fuji Xerox, a joint venture of Fuji Film and Xerox, provides digital imagine and printing equipment to the Asian market. Its products include digital printers, digital copiers, multi-function machines, projectors, engineering plotters, image processing systems, fax machines, and related software.About KDI Knowledge Benchmarking Program
